Hydraulic tilt pump gets quite hard but the cab doesn't move up, not sure of the procedure to raise the cab, the pump handle was missing but manufactured one to operate the valve, have I get the sequence wrong or do I get a bigger handle? Just picked up this vehicle without a handbook.

May be a silly question but you have moved the lever for up and down on the side of the pump ? If so it may be that the cab lock has not released if it hasn't you will have to try and undo it or try lever the catch across if you can get to it , if not release the bar that the mounts attach to
